  4. They aren't playing full games . Right now it's 4-5 innings max for intrasquad games. They will probably increase it until they are ready to go 9 for the 3 exhibition games starting July 19. Just 3 exhibition games before the season starts that same week July 24.

  8. No one's mentioned it but Wells pissed us all off by suggesting Big Frank was a big baby by not playing through injury. Then a few days after all that Thomas's father died after a long illness so he was dealing with that too. http://www.espn.com/mlb/news/2001/0504/1191141.html It was shortly after that when Frank got shut down for the rest of the season. https://tht.fangraphs.com/tht-live/10th-anniversary-of-david-wells-most-asinine-moment-5-3-11/
